About Osteopathy

Osteopathy is a holistic, manual therapy that focuses on correcting joint malfunction. Commonly thought to only treat the spine, osteopathy looks at function of joints in the whole-body, including muscles, ligaments, and tendons.




Osteopathy uses massage and other physical manipulations of muscle tissue and bones to treat a range of medical disorders. It aims to assist the body to gain normal pain-free movement and function.



An osteopathy degree takes five years to complete, and practitioners must be registered by law with the Australian Health Practitioner Registration Agency and treatments are covered by most health funds.

Muscular & Joint Function

Osteopaths focus on the health of the entire body, rather than just the injured or affected part. They look at how your skeleton, joints, muscles, nerves, circulatory system, connective tissue and internal organs function as a whole body unit.



In accordance with osteopathic principles, treatments are tailored to each individual, with safety being the prime consideration. And practitioners will generally explain the type of technique to be used, before commencing treatment.



Osteopaths often offer advice on self-help measures and lifetime issues such as diet, posture, stress management and exercise to assist with the treatments they offer. They will also refer patients to other health care practitioners when necessary.



Osteopathic treatments are mostly gentle and painless; however, it is not uncommon to feel tender for a couple of days following a treatment.

Typical Problems Treated

  • Middle back pain
  • Upper back pain
  • Muscular sprains and strains
  • Neck pain
  • Postural issues
  • Hip, knee or foot pain
  • Occupational & Repetitive strain injuries
  • Sciatica
  • Scoliosis
  • Pain in your joints
  • Headaches
  • Shoulder or elbow pain
  • Whiplash
  • Arthritis
  • Tendinitis
  • Sports injuries.

When used together with medical management, osteopathy can also be effective in reducing the severity and frequency of symptoms in other conditions such as migraines, dysmenorrhea and tinnitus.
